Signature Personal Loans
These loans offer flexibility and convenience, allowing you to use the funds for various purposes. Signature loans are unsecured, with a credit limit capped at three times your gross monthly income or a maximum of $40,000. Features of these loans include:

How to Apply for a Space Coast Credit Union Personal Loan?
Visit the Website. Go to the Space Coast Credit Union website and navigate to the "Personal" section.
Select Loan Type. Choose the type of personal loan you're interested in. You'll be given options to apply for a loan without collateral or by securing it using an SCCU CD or savings.
Provide Loan Information. Fill in the required loan information, including the amount you're requesting (minimum $1,000) and the desired loan term, which can range from 12 to 60 months. Specify the reason for the loan.

Upgrade
Upgrade is a prominent online lender that offers personal loans to borrowers with bad credit. They provide loan amounts ranging from $1,000 to $50,000, making them suitable for various financial needs. The minimum credit score required by Upgrade is relatively low, typically around 580. This makes it accessible to individuals with a less-than-stellar credit history. One notable advantage of Upgrade is its flexible repayment terms, which can extend up to five years. This longer repayment period allows borrowers to manage their monthly payments more effectively. However, it's worth noting that Upgrade charges origination fees ranging from 2.9% to 8%. Additionally, while they do not have any prepayment penalties, borrowers should be aware of the interest rates, which can be relatively high for individuals with bad credit.

Upstart
Upstart is another online lender that specializes in providing loans to borrowers with bad credit. Their loan amounts range from $1,000 to $50,000, allowing borrowers to access the funds they need for various purposes. Upstart utilizes a unique underwriting model that takes into account factors beyond just credit scores, making it more inclusive for individuals with limited credit history or low credit scores. The minimum credit score required by Upstart is typically around 580. One of the significant advantages of Upstart is its soft credit check, which means that applying for a loan does not negatively impact your credit score. Repayment terms offered by Upstart range from three to five years, providing borrowers with flexibility. While they do charge origination fees of up to 8%, it's important to note that they don't impose any prepayment penalties. However, borrowers with bad credit should expect higher interest rates.

LendingPoint
LendingPoint is a bad credit lender that offers personal loans ranging from $2,000 to $36,500. They consider borrowers with credit scores as low as 585, making them accessible to individuals with bad credit. LendingPoint prides itself on providing fast funding, often disbursing funds within one business day. Their repayment terms typically range from two to four years, allowing borrowers to tailor their loan duration according to their needs. It's important to note that LendingPoint does charge origination fees that can be up to 6%. They also have a slightly higher interest rate compared to traditional lenders, which is to be expected when borrowing with bad credit. However, they do not impose any prepayment penalties, enabling borrowers to pay off their loans early if they desire.

How to Pay off a Space Coast Credit Union Personal Loan?
Online or Mobile Banking. You can easily make payments using SCCU's Online Banking or Mobile Banking platform. Log in to your account and select "Pay My SCCU Loan" at the top of your dashboard. You can choose to pay from your SCCU account or an external bank account. This option allows you to set up one-time or recurring payments.
Mobile Wallet Loan Payments. If you use mobile wallet apps like Apple Wallet or Google Pay (GPay), you can add your SCCU Auto or Home Loan to the app. This enables you to make secure and convenient one-time loan payments directly through your mobile wallet.
SCCU Branch. Visit an SCCU branch to make a payment. You can use your SCCU account, write a check, provide a cash payment, or perform a cash advance from a credit card or non-SCCU debit card. Please note that fees may apply for certain payment methods.
SCCU's Automated Phone System. You can use SCCU's automated phone system to make payments. Simply call the appropriate local number based on your area and follow the prompts. Have your PIN ready for verification.
Mail. You can send a payment by mail. Include your account number and send a check to the address provided below. Acceptable forms of payment include personal or business checks, on-us checks, teller checks, money orders, and debit cards.
Mail Payment Address. Space Coast Credit Union P.O. Box 419001 Melbourne, FL 32941-9001

Alternatives
Online Lenders. Online lending platforms like SoFi and LightStream offer personal loans with competitive rates and flexible terms. These lenders often streamline the application process and provide quick funding. SoFi focuses on various loan types, including student loan refinancing, while LightStream offers low-interest loans for various purposes.
Traditional Banks. Established banks like Wells Fargo, Regions Bank, and Fifth Third Bank provide personal loan options. These banks offer the convenience of in-person service and may provide discounts for existing customers or those with certain accounts.
Other Credit Unions. Similar to SCCU, other credit unions offer personal loans with varying terms and rates. Research credit unions in your area or those you can join to explore their loan offerings.
Peer-to-peer lending platforms such as Prosper and LendingClub connect borrowers with individual investors willing to fund loans. This approach can provide competitive rates and terms outside of traditional financial institutions.
Credit Card Balance Transfers. If you have existing credit card debt, some credit card companies offer balance transfer promotions with low or 0% interest rates for a limited time. Transferring high-interest debt to a lower-interest credit card can be cost-effective if managed carefully.
Home Equity Loans or Lines of Credit. If you own a home, you might consider a home equity loan or a home equity line of credit (HELOC). These options use your home's equity as collateral and typically offer lower interest rates compared to unsecured personal loans.
Borrowing from Retirement Accounts. Depending on your retirement plan, you might be able to borrow from your 401(k) or other retirement accounts. While this can provide quick access to funds, it's important to consider potential tax implications and the impact on your long-term savings.
